Urgent.. Results of the first day’s women’s competitions of the 2024 World Squash Championship

The activities of the CIB World Squash Championship 2024 kicked off today, which continues until May 18, and the first preliminary round witnessed epic confrontations with the participation of 64 women players. The matches started at 12 noon and continued until 10 pm at the Palm Hills October Club stadiums, with the National Museum of Egyptian Civilization hosting the matches starting from the quarter-finals until the tournament finals.

The women’s matches concluded with a match between the Egyptian player Nour El-Sherbini, the world’s first-ranked Sporting Club player, and Jessica Turnbull, where El-Sherbiny defeated Turnbull with a score of (3-0) with a score of (11-0), (11-4), (11-4), so that “El-Sherbini” qualified for the tournament. To confront "Hamid" In the next round.

 

Palm Hills’ hosting of the 2024 CIB World Squash Championship at Palm Hills Sports Club comes in line with the strategy of Palm Hills Sports Investment Company, with the aim of supporting Egyptian players and contributing to Strengthening Egypt’s leadership position in squash and supporting squash talent to qualify for the 2028 Los Angeles Olympics.
